Market Overview

Home Prices in Moran, KS

The median home value in Moran, KS is $81,649 as of mid-2026, according to Zillow's Home Value Index (ZHVI).That's up 4% compared to a year ago and down 13% from two years prior.

Compared to the U.S. national median of $410,000, homes in Moran are priced80% below average.

Over the past five years, Moran home values have risen by approximately11.6%, reflecting steady appreciation in this market.
